2012-05-02 3 views
0

私は目的のcOSで電子メールを作成して入力するコードを作成しましたが、ユーザーは内容を変更しないようにする必要があります。ユーザーはまだ電子メールを送信できません。 これは可能ですか?もしそうなら、どうですか? 乾杯してくださいiOSで読み取り専用Eメールを作成するには?

答えて

2

メッセージをiOSのメールフレームワーク以外の方法でMTAに送信する必要があります。メールフレームワークを使用すると、ユーザーはそのメッセージを編集できます。 2つのオプションは次のとおりです。

  • 独自のSMTPクライアントをアプリケーションに直接実装します。メッセージを送信しているだけなので、これはあまり複雑ではありません。

  • ウェブサービスやその他のインターフェースを介して別のマシンにメッセージを送信し、そのマシンに代わってメッセージを送信させるようにしてください。

+1

などのコンテンツを添付することができます自信を持って – stan4th

0

パブリックAPIでこれを行う方法はありません。

to:アドレス、件名、メールの本文をあらかじめ入力することはできますが、必要に応じてユーザーはいつでも変更できます。

2

あなたはSMTPオプションは、多くの場合、私は他のプラットフォームにかかるだろうなアプローチになると誰かが、これはiOSの上で合理的なアプローチであることを私に保証している場合、私はそのルートをたどることができますPDFファイル

+0

+1いい考えですが、ユーザーはメッセージを編集してPDF添付ファイルを削除する可能性があるため、OPの要件を満たしていない可能性があります。 – Caleb

関連する問題